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bare-tailed Woolly Opossum | Goldman's Nectar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(प्राणी) | Animalia (प्राणी)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(रज्जुकी) | Chordata (रज्जुकी) |
| Class same | Mammalia (स्तनधारी) | Mammalia (स्तनधारी) |
| Order |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ia) | Chiroptera (चमगादड़) |
| Family | Didelphidae | Phyllostomidae |
| Genus | Caluromys | Lonchophylla |
| Species | Caluromys philander | Lonchophylla mordax |
Evolutionary Relationship
Bare-tailed Woolly Opossum and Goldman's Nectar Bat share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(स्तनधारी)
